Day 1 - Nosy Be
Day 1 - Nosy Be
Welcome to Madagascar and the island of Nosy Be! On arrival at the airport, you will be met and transferred to your hotel, where you'll be served a complimentary welcome cocktail. Your first evening in Madagascar is free to relax in the hotel or to head out and explore.
Day 2 - Nosy Sakatia
Day 2 - Nosy Sakatia
Bemoko - Nosy Sakatia - Bemoko. After breakfast, set off for the island of Nosy Sakatia, a hidden gem untouched by modern life. With a local guide, explore its lush landscapes on a 1.5-hour trek, winding through forests of flamboyant trees, coffee, pepper, vanilla, mango, and guava. Along the way, meet local villagers and glimpse their daily traditions. You'll have the opportunity to swim with sea turtles too, the exact timing will depend on the tide times. Return to the hotel on Nosy Be in the evening.
Day 3 - Nosy Komba & Nosy Tanikely
Day 3 - Nosy Komba & Nosy Tanikely
Bemoko - Nosy Komba - Nosy Tanikely - Bemoko. Set sail on a catamaran mini-cruise to explore two striking islands near Nosy Be. Your first stop, Nosy Komba, is a traditional fishing village known for its handicraft market—perfect for finding local sculptures and embroidered tablecloths. The island is also home to a small lemur park, where you can see these playful primates up close.
Next, arrive at Nosy Tanikely, a protected marine reserve teeming with vibrant coral reefs, anemones, and sea turtles. Dive into its crystal-clear waters for a snorkelling experience that feels like stepping into a giant aquarium (equipment provided). After your underwater adventure, enjoy a fresh seafood picnic on board the catamaran.
Day 4 - Leisure Day in Nosy Be
Day 4 - Leisure Day in Nosy Be
Bemoko - Take the day to unwind or explore at your own pace. Whether you choose to relax by the water, discover hidden spots, or immerse yourself in the local culture, the time is yours to enjoy.
Day 5 - Turtle Island Adventure
Day 5 - Turtle Island Adventure
Bemoko - Nosy Iranja - Bemoko. Step into paradise as you visit Nosy Iranja, often named one of the world's ten most beautiful islands. Just an hour and a half by speedboat from Nosy Be, Nosy Iranja is made up of Small Iranja and Great Iranja, connected by a stunning white sandbank that appears at low tide. The island’s turquoise waters and tranquil atmosphere make it feel like a secret haven.
Known as Turtle Island, it's where sea turtles come to nest, and you'll likely spot them in the crystal-clear waters. The island is also home to a variety of seabirds, including stern gulls and marine eagles. After a relaxing picnic lunch under the shade of coconut trees, take a leisurely stroll to the lighthouse on Great Iranja or explore the peaceful Iranja village—a perfect way to soak in the island’s charm.
Day 6 - Explore Nosy Be’s Rainforest
Day 6 - Explore Nosy Be’s Rainforest
Bemoko - Lokobe Reserve - Bemoko. Lokobe Reserve is the last remaining primary forest on Nosy Be, a true haven of endemic plants and ancient trees. It’s a hotspot for scientists drawn to its rich biodiversity. The reserve is home to a fascinating mix of wildlife, from nocturnal lemurs like the Macaco and Lepilemurs to chameleons, tropical birds, chameleons and even snakes.
After exploring the reserve, experience a cart ride to the village of Ambatozavavy, where you'll board a traditional boat or motorboat to navigate the mangroves. You’ll return to the hotel by 3:30-4 pm, having experienced the lush, wild beauty of this unique reserve.
Day 7 - Nosy Be From East to West
Day 7 - Nosy Be From East to West
Bemoko - Hell-Ville - Bemoko. Today you will take in the best of Nosy Be, including Lemuria Land, a wildlife park home to numerous lemur species. In Hell-Ville, the island's lively centre, you'll find colonial-era buildings and a bustling market full of local life.
As you venture beyond Hell-Ville, breathe in the fragrant scents of coffee, pepper, vanilla, and Ylang Ylang while admiring the sacred Banyan tree. The tour concludes with a visit to Mont Passot, the highest point on Nosy Be, where you can take in a breathtaking sunset before returning to the hotel.
Day 8 - Nosy Be
Day 8 - Nosy Be
After breakfast at the hotel, it's time to check out. An included transfer takes you to the airport for your onward flight. Safe travels!
